Light level of sensitivity may show a much more significant trouble and is a common symptom of a variety of eye conditions, illness, and infections


Seasonal allergies can make our eyes dry and itchy, as can extended screen usage. vision center south wetumpka. It might additionally show that you have dry eye. Dry eye is a chronic condition that can be taken care of making use of a range of non-invasive in-office and at-home treatments. Reserve a visit with your eye physician to see if you are experiencing dry eye.


They are triggered by bits of protein and various other tissue that are embedded in the clear, gel-like material (called vitreous) which loads the within our eye. As we age the vitreous ends up being even more liquid, making the littles protein and various other cells more obvious. Some advances (specifically those accompanied by flashes of light) might show a really serious problem, such as a detached retina.


Make an emergency visit with your optometrist or proceed to the closest emergency area. The majority of retinal detachments can be fixed if they are treated soon, however if they are not dealt with in time you might experience a loss of vision or even loss of sight. If you are seeing halos around lights, specifically throughout the middle of the day, it might indicate that you have astigmatism or presbyopia. It may also show that something much a lot more significant is going on, so you must make a consultation with your eye physician as quickly as possible.


Issues with nighttime vision may also show that you are beginning to establish cataracts. Cataracts can just be treated utilizing surgical procedure, but your ophthalmologist can recommend steps you can take to slow the progression of cataracts. According to the Canadian Organization of Optometrists grownups with healthy eyes in between the ages of 20 and 39 should see their optometrist every 2 to 3 years. Grownups in between the ages of 40 and 64 must make an appointment once every 2 years, and adults over the age of 64 ought to see their optometrist each year.

The retina is the thin layer of cells that lines the inner part of the rear of the eyeball. Its duty is to get light and send aesthetic signals to the brain.

Glaucoma is an eye condition that can cause irreversible vision loss. It takes place when fluid builds up within the eye. The excess liquid puts stress on delicate retinal nerve fibers, triggering damage to the optic nerve. Without treatment, this can cause a person to gradually shed their field of vision.
